JOB SUMMARY:

The Marketing / Communications Director is responsible for the activities of the Marketing / Communications team, develops department budgets, policies and procedures and is responsible for planning, organizing, directing and managing the bank's internal and external marketing and communications initiatives, including but not limited to; advertising, brand management, data analytics, strategic planning/designing/development/directing of marketing campaigns, digital platforms, employee communications and coordinating public relations messaging with the President.
